Boys of St. Vincent, The (TV Movie) (1992)
Aka: Collège St. Vincent, Le ; Garçons de Saint-Vincent, Les (French titles)This movie is based on actual events, but it says it is not all about one specific incident. It documents St. Vincent's Orphanage in Canada, where many of the boys suffer physical, emotional, and sexual abuse at the hands of the brothers who run the facility. When the stories are surfaced and a police investigation is begun, religious and political groups work to silence the story to keep it from reaching the public.
